We are straight up OBSESSED with frybread.

In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the dough hook attachment, mix the flour, salt, and baking powder to combine. Add the melted butter and water and mix on low speed until the mixture forms a smooth dough, 2-3 minutes.

You can also mix the dough by hand—start by using a flexible spatula for 1-2 minutes and then switch to your hands once the mixture comes together. Knead for 4-6 minutes until smooth.Lightly flour your work surface. Unwrap the dough and divide it into 12 even pieces. Working one piece at a time, roll out the dough into a round about 1/4 -1/3 inch thick. Pierce the center of each piece of dough with a paring knife.

Working in batches , fry the dough until golden brown on both sides, 2-4 minutes per side. If large bubbles form in the dough, you can pierce them with the tip of a knife to remove the excess air.Serve warm or at room temperature, plain or with toppings.
